... hien thi "R" STA DataI79 MVI A, 79h ;cho hien thi "E" STA DataI79 MVI A, 77h ;cho hien thi "A" STA DataI79 MVI A, 5Eh ;cho hien thi "D" STA DataI79 MVI A, 6Eh ;cho hien thi "Y" STA DataI79 POP PSW 48 ... khoa ngoai phim MVI A, 3Eh ;lap trinh xung Clock = 100 KHz STA CntI79 MVI A, 0C3h ;xoa hien thi va xoa FIFO STA CntI79 MVI A, 01h ;tri hoan 0.1 ms > 160 us CALL DELAY MVI A, 90h ;bat dau ghi vao tai ... khoa ngoai phim MVI A, 3Eh ;lap trinh xung Clock = 100 KHz STA CntI79 MVI A, 0C3h ;xoa hien thi va xoa FIFO STA CntI79 MVI A, 01h ;tri hoan 0.1 ms > 160 us CALL DELAY MVI A, 90h ;bat dau ghi vao tai...
... E4 E3 E2 E1 E0 ACC D D D D D D – D PSW – – – BC BB B B9 B8 A IP B7 B6 B5 B4 B3 B2 B1 B0 P3 AF – – AAA A9 A8 C B A IE A7 A6 A A4 A3 A2 A1 A0 P2 không đ a h a bit 9F 9E 9D 9C 9B 9A 99 98 SBUF SCON ... xuất trực tiếp giống đ a nhớ khác • Ngăn xếp bên RAM nội nhỏ so với RAM vixửlý khác Chi tiết nhớ RAM chip: Theo hình vẽ sau, RAM bên 8051/8031 phân chia bank ghi (00H–1FH), RAM đ a h a bit (20H–2FH), ... vixửlý nhận b2=1 : liệu gởi từ PC đến vixửlý bò lỗi - byte length : số byte chuỗi data cộng byte “↵” kết thúc frame truyền - Các byte data : mang thông tin yêu cầu master (PC) slave (vi xử...
... Thống Kê Joseph Vithayathil POWER ELECTRONICS Principles and Application McGraw-Hill, Inc C.J.SAVANT,Jr MARTIN S.RODEN GORDON L CARPENTER ELECTRONIC DESIGN http://kilobooks.com THƯ VI N ĐIỆN TỬ ... đ a xung kích Sau có xung đơn ổn xung dao động tần số cao, ta trộn chúng lại với cổng AND IC2 Kết cho ta chuổi xung kích khoảng xung đơn ổn mức cao Các xung kích đ a đến OPTO 4N2 6A 4N26B để đ a ... đủ nhỏ (so với thời gian làm vi c) nên dòng điện coi không đổi giai đoạn có trò số Icmax Đối với điện trở R ta chọn cho trò số v a đủ lớn để dòng điện qua không đáng kể so với dòng dao động mạch...
... tại& Tuy nhiên vi c nghiên cứu tham khảo tài liệu bảo đảm tính kế th a phát triễn có chọn lọc Xửlý kiện: Các kiện sau thu thập ch a thể sử dụng mà phải qua trình sàng lọc, s a ch a, phân tích ... pháp nghiên cứu phù hợp với đề tài, nói khác đề tài nghiên cứu phải mang tính v a sức Người nghiên cứu phải thể dực nghiên cứu khoa học bao gồm vi c nắm vững lý thuyết khoa học lónh vực nghiên ... tế khách quan Có thể nói công trình nghiên cứu điều có giá trò thực tế nó, khác mức độ nhiều, phục vụ trước mắt hay lâu dài, gián tiếp hay trực tiếp Tác động điều kiện khách quan đến vi c thực...
... xảy ALU ghi A, cần lưu ý hầt hết sau thực phép tính, ALU thường gởi liệu vào ghi A làm liệu ghi A trước bò Thanh ghi A thường làm trung gian để trao liệu vixửlývới thiết bò ngoại viVớivixử ... nhớ Với nhiệm vụ đònh đ a thiết bò cần truy xuất nên đường đ a mang tính chiều có vixửlý có khả đ a đ a lên đường đ a - Đường liệu: dùng để kết nối ghi bên vixửlývới khối khác bên vixửlý ... trúc vixửlý8085 Instruction Decoder Data Register ALU Address Register Program Counter Logic Control Hình 1.1 : Sơ đồ khối vixửlý bit 16 bit Address Memory Address Register Low High Accumulator...
... delay Mvi c, 08h ;làm biến điếm cho chương trình x a Mvi a, 00h Vd3 sta 0a0 00h Dcr c Jnz vd3 Mvi 0, 01h Call 0310h Jmp vd1 ;nạp 00 vào A ;gởi led để x a ;giảm biến đếm ;quay lại vd3 ch a x a đủ ... ADDR Lệnh nhảy bit S=1: + Cú pháp: JM ADDR XVI NHÓM LỆNH GỌI: Lệnh gọi không điều kiện: + Cú pháp: CAAL + Mã đối 1 ADDR 0 1 bit thấp bit cao tượng: + Ý ngh a: vixửlý thực chương trình đ a ADDR ... VỚI THANH GHI A: Lệnh cộng với ô nhớ: + Cú pháp: ADD M + Mã đối tượng: 0 0 1 + Ý ngh a: nội dung ghi A cộng với nội dung ô nhớ có đ a ch a cặp ghi HL, kết ch a ghi A, nội dung ô nhớ không thay...
... cho phép gởi liệu trực tiếp đến led led, tổ chức led thay đay đổi đ a gởi liệu A0 00H mổi led có thêm đ a điều khiển hình 4.4 đ a led phải gởi đ a A001H trước gởi liệu đ a A000H LED8 80H LED7 81H ... hướng từ phải sang trái hình 4.2 LED LED7 LED LED LED4 LED LED LE D1 Hình 4.2 Vùng đ a sử dụng IC 8279 A0 00HA001H, đó: + Đ a A000H đại dùng để gửi liệu cần hiển thò + Đ a A001H đ a dùng để gởi ... dụng IC 6264 + RAM có đ a từ 6000h – 7FFFh +ø RAM có đ a từ 8000h – 9FFFh + Các vùng nhớ RAM sử dụng có đ a 87F8h đến 87FFh Chương trình sữ dụng toàn vùng nhớ RAM lại Các IC ngoại vi: Trong hệ thống...
... cặp ghi - /WR nối với chân /WR vixửlý - /RD nối với chân /RD vixửlý - CLK nối với đường dây CLK vixửlý - Reset nối với đường dây reset vixửlý - D0 … D7 nối với đường dẫn D0…D7 VXL b Nhóm ... khối a nhóm tín hiệu ghép nối vớivixửlý gồm: - /CS nối với giải mã đ a A1 An để chọn ghi (A0 = 1điều khiển trạng thái, A0 = đệm số liệu) - C/D nối với đường dây đ a A0 để cặp ghi - /WR nối với ... transmit data RxD – receiver data TxRDy – transmit ready RxRDy – receiver ready TxEMTY – transmist register empty Syn/BRK- Break detect Thanh ghi truyền Thanh ghi đệm truyền Thanh ghi nhận RxD Thanh...
... out 01h call delay mvi a, 0ceh out 01h call delay mvi a, 26h out 01h call delay ;xoa cac ;nap tu che ;nap tu lenh y5: in 01h ani 82h cpi 82h jnz y5 in 00h thap mov e ,a mov l ,a ;cat byte dia chi y6: ... mov h ,a out 00h call delay mvi a, 21h out 01h call delay inr e mvi a, 03h out 01h call delay x13: in 01h ani 81h cpi 81h jnz x13 ldax d mov c ,a out 00 ;doc byte tu lenh de call delay mvi a, 21h ... call delay mvi a, 40h ;xoa cac ghi noi out 01h call delay mvi a, 0ceh ;goi tu dk che out 01h call delay lxi d,6500h mvi a, 03h ;goi tu lenh out 01h call delay x1: in 01 ;doc tg trang thai ani 10000001b...
... nối với máy in, Thanh ghi trao đổi qua ô nhớ vùng vào/ra (input/output) Đ a tới cổng nối tiếp gọi đ a (basic Address) đ a ghi đạt tới vi c cộng thêm số ghi gặp UART vào đ a Đ a cổng nối tiếp ... khác kiểm tra sau: + Rãnh cắm 16 bit theo tiêu chuẩn ISA (Industry standard Architecture) + Rãnh cắm PS/2 với 16 bit theo tiêu chuẩn MCA (Micro Channel Architecture) + Rãnh cắm PC/2 với 32 bit ... BUSY =1 , ACK =0 ĐỌC DỮ LIỆU ACK = XỬLÝ DỮ LIỆU HÌNH 3.4 BUSY = GIAO TIẾP QUA SLOT CARD (có đ a từ 300 31FH) Trong máy tính người ta chế tạo sẵn slot cho phép người sử dụng tính máy vi tính cách...
... Trap RST 7.5 RST 6.5 RST 5.5 INTR INTA\ AD0 AD1 AD2 AD3 AD4 AD5 AD6 AD7 Vss 40 808 5A 20 21 Vcc HOLD HLDA Clock out Reset in READY IO/M\ S1 RD\ WR\ ALE S0 A1 5 A1 4 A1 3 A1 2 A1 1 A1 0 A9 A8 A8 – A1 5 ... hai ngõ vào, nơi đặt thạch anh Nhiệm vụ tạo dao động cho khối bên vixửlý - Vixửlý khác có tần số làm vi c khác nhau, sau tần số làm vi c cực đại vài vixửlý Intel sản xuất: 6MHz 808 5A ... nhớ hay I/0 vixửlý - Chân RD\ vixửlý 808 5A thường nối với chân RD IC khác (bộ nhớ hay I/0) * Chân 35: Ready (Input): - Ready: Tức tín hiệu trả lời cho vixửlý Bộ nhớ hay thiết bò ngoại vi...
... NHỚ : Với nhớ (1EPROM hay RAM) để vixửlý truy xuất hết Kbyte nhớ phải tiến hành kết nối 13 đường đ a A1 2A1 1A1 0A9 A 8A7 A 6A5 A 4A3 A 2A1 A0 vixửlý đến 13 đường đ a A1 2A1 1A1 0A9 A 8A7 A 6A5 A 4A3 A 2A1 A0 nhớ ... KẾT NỐI BỘ NHỚ VỚIVIXỬLÝ Bộ nhớ có vai trò quan trọng hệ thống vixử lý, hoạt động nhớ gắn liền với hoạt động vixử lý, nơi lưu trữ liệu để vixửlýxửlý nhớ diện hệ thống vixửlý sử dụng phải ... thái vi mạch 2764: Vpp A1 2 A7 A6 A5 A4 A3 A2 A1 A0 D0 D1 D2 GND 27 26 25 24 23 Vcc PGM\ NC A8 A9 A1 1 OE\ A1 0 CE\ D7 D6 D5 D4 D3 28 22 2764 21 20 10 19 11 18 12 17 13 16 14 15 A0 A1 D0 A1 1 A1 2...
... LOOP END DX, 0FFF2h AL,00h DX,AL CX 2h D0 DX, AL CX,2h D1 DX, AL CX,2h D2 AL, 40h DX, AL CX, 2h D3 AL, 11001110B DX, AL CX, 2h D4 Truyền thông tin nối tiếp kit VXL máy tính: A – A 11 Giải mã điạ ... Một 8251 có điạ gốc CS\ với 0FFF0h, cần trao đổi thông tin bit, tốc độ x16 kiểm tra Parity chẵn lẻ, 2bit stop Lời điều khiển là: 1 0 1 Lưu đồ khởi tạo 825 1A Begin 00h ghi điều khiển 03h AH AH ... GND D – D7 TxD Rest RxD CLK DTR C/D\ Reset CLK A0 RD \ RD \ WR \ INTR CS \ WR\ Xửlý ngắt (825 9A hai mức) DSR\ RTS \ TxD CTS\ RxRDy INTA \ VXL 8251 HÌNH 5.6 O O O O O O O O O Cổng COM máy tính...
... theo yêu cầu thời gian quy đònh Trong luận văn chúng em thực công vi c sau: Khảo sát phần lý thuyết: - Giới thiệu vixửlý - Giới thiệu cách giao tiếp - khảo sát kit vixửlý8085 Thi công mạch ... cảm bỏ qua Người thực mong mỏi bạn sinh vi n khoa điện kh a sau bổ xung cho luận văn hoàn chỉnh Sinh vi n thực Nguyễn Trung Dũng HƯỚNG PHÁT TRIỂN ĐỀ TÀI Ngày với phát triển nhanh chóng khoa học ... nước ta chuyển sang sản xuất công nghiệp Do đó, để đáp ứng với nhu cầu thực tế cần phải nghiên cứu thêm loại giao diện nối tiếp khác để tăng thêm khoảng cách tốc độ truyền Ngoài ra, d a tập luận...
... PIR1 (đ a 0Ch): ch a cờ ngắt AD (bit ADIF) • PIE1 (đ a 8Ch): ch a bit điều khiển AD (ADIE) • ADRESH (đ a 1Eh) ADRESL (đ a 9Eh): ghi ch a kết chuyển đổi AD • ADCON0 (đ a 1Fh) ADCON1 (đ a 9Fh): ... thông số cho chuyển đổi AD • PORTA (đ a 05h) TRISA (đ a 85h): liên quan đến ngõ vào analog PORTA PORTE (đ a 09h) TRISE (đ a 89h): liên quan đến ngõ vào analog PORTE Trang 23 Đồ án tốt nghiệp ... PORTA SETUP_ADC(ADC_CLOCK_INTERNAL); Trang 39 Đồ án tốt nghiệp GVHD: Nguyễn Văn Trung SETUP_ADC_PORTS(AN0_AN1_AN2_AN4_AN5_VSS_VREF); SET_ADC_CHANNEL(2); DELAY_us(1000); } VOID XUATLED() { hc...
... 13 đường đ a A1 2A1 1A1 0A9 A 8A7 A 6A5 A 4A3 A 2A1 A0 vixửlý đến 13 đường đ a A1 2A1 1A1 0A9 A 8A7 A 6A5 A 4A3 A 2A1 A0 nhớ tất 13 đường đ a EPROM RAM nối với 13 đường đ avixửlý để truyền tín hiệu với đường liệu ... Trap RST 7.5 RST 6.5 RST 5.5 INTR INTA\ AD0 AD1 AD2 AD3 AD4 AD5 AD6 AD7 Vss 40 808 5A 20 21 Vcc HOLD HLDA Clock out Reset in READY IO/M\ S1 RD\ WR\ ALE S0 A1 5 A1 4 A1 3 A1 2 A1 1 A1 0 A9 A8 A8 – A1 5 ... hai ngõ vào, nơi đặt thạch anh Nhiệm vụ tạo dao động cho khối bên vixửlý - Vixửlý khác có tần số làm vi c khác nhau, sau tần số làm vi c cực đại vài vixửlý Intel sản xuất: • 6MHz 8085A...
... 13 đường đ aA 1 2A1 1A1 0A9 A 8A7 A 6A5 A 4A3 A 2A1 A0 vixửlý đến 13 đường đ a A1 2A1 1A1 0A9 A 8A7 A 6A5 A 4A3 A 2A1 A0 nhớ tất 13 đường đ a EPROM RAM nối với 13 đường đ avixửlý để truyền tín hiệu với đường liệu ... Trap RST 7.5 RST 6.5 RST 5.5 INTR INTA\ AD0 AD1 AD2 AD3 AD4 AD5 AD6 AD7 Vss 40 808 5A 20 21 Vcc HOLD HLDA Clock out Reset in READY IO/M\ S1 RD\ WR\ ALE S0 A1 5 A1 4 A1 3 A1 2 A1 1 A1 0 A9 A8 A8 – A1 5 ... đ a thiết bò cần truy xuất nên đường đ a mang tính chiều có vixửlý có khả đ a đ a lên đường đ a - Đường liệu: dùng để kết nối ghi bên vixửlývới khối khác bên vixửlý chuyển liệu Vixử lý...
... NHỚ : Với nhớ (1EPROM hay RAM) để vixửlý truy xuất hết Kbyte nhớ phải tiến hành kết nối 13 đường đ a A1 2A1 1A1 0A9 A 8A7 A 6A5 A 4A3 A 2A1 A0 vixửlý đến 13 đường đ a A1 2A1 1A1 0A9 A 8A7 A 6A5 A 4A3 A 2A1 A0 nhớ ... HOLD HLDA Clock out Reset in READY IO/M\ S1 RD\ WR\ ALE S0 A1 5 A1 4 A1 3 A1 2 A1 1 A1 0 A9 A8 A8 – A1 5 Ready Hold Intr RST 7.5 RST 6.5 RST 5.5 Trap Reset in X1 X2 808 5A SID Vcc Vss AD0 – AD7 ALE S0 ... động cho khối bên vixửlý - Vixửlý khác có tần số làm vi c khác nhau, sau tần số làm vi c cực đại vài vixửlý Intel sản xuất: 6MHz 808 5A 10MHz 808 5A- 2 12 MHz 808 5A- 1 * Chân 3: Reset...
... 13 đường đ a A1 2A1 1A1 0A9 A 8A7 A 6A5 A 4A3 A 2A1 A0 vixửlý đến 13 đường đ a A1 2A1 1A1 0A9 A 8A7 A 6A5 A 4A3 A 2A1 A0 nhớ tất 13 đường đ a EPROM RAM nối với 13 đường đ avixửlý để truyền tín hiệu với đường liệu ... Trap RST 7.5 RST 6.5 RST 5.5 INTR INTA\ AD0 AD1 AD2 AD3 AD4 AD5 AD6 AD7 Vss 40 808 5A 20 21 Vcc HOLD HLDA Clock out Reset in READY IO/M\ S1 RD\ WR\ ALE S0 A1 5 A1 4 A1 3 A1 2 A1 1 A1 0 A9 A8 A8 – A1 5 ... xảy ALU ghi A, cần lưu ý hầt hết sau thực phép tính, ALU thường gởi liệu vào ghi A làm liệu ghi A trước bị Thanh ghi A thường làm trung gian để trao liệu vixửlývới thiết bị ngoại viVớivi xử...